Electro-chemical Energy Storage Systems Market Analysis
By Technology
The Electro-chemical Energy Storage Systems market is significantly influenced by various technologies, with lithium-ion batteries dominating the landscape due to their high energy density, efficiency, and declining costs. Used extensively in consumer electronics, electric vehicles, and grid storage applications, lithium-ion technology continues to see rapid advancements. Sodium sulfur batteries are emerging as a strong alternative, particularly in large-scale energy storage applications, due to their high energy capacity and robustness in extreme operating conditions. Lead acid batteries, while facing obsolescence in some sectors, remain a cost-effective solution for stationary applications and backup power systems, contributing to their sustained presence in the market. Flow batteries, which offer the advantage of scalable power capacity and longevity, are becoming increasingly popular for renewable energy integration and applications requiring prolonged discharge times. Other emerging technologies, including solid-state batteries and metal-air systems, are also being investigated, and while they currently represent a smaller segment, they have the potential to disrupt the market in the coming years.
By Application
In terms of applications, the Electro-chemical Energy Storage Systems market is diversified, reflecting the various sectors that leverage these technologies. The grid storage segment is a pivotal application, driven by the need for energy reliability and efficiency as renewable energy sources like solar and wind become more prevalent. Energy storage systems are critical for grid stability, frequency regulation, and peak shaving. The transportation sector, particularly electric vehicles, is another key driver of growth in this market. As governments and consumers increasingly push for cleaner transportation solutions, the demand for high-capacity batteries will continue to rise. Additionally, off-grid applications are gaining traction, especially in remote areas where traditional energy sources are unreliable or unavailable. Industrial applications, including backup power solutions and load levelling, are also important and are expected to grow as energy management becomes more sophisticated. Overall, the diverse range of applications fuels the ongoing innovation and expansion within the Electro-chemical Energy Storage Systems market, ensuring its critical role in a sustainable energy future.
